+// Given a member that was extracted from an instance, convert it correctly
+// and put the result in the dest[] array for a possible method call.
+// Conversion means dealing with static/class methods, callables, and values.
+// see http://docs.python.org/3/howto/descriptor.html
+void mp_convert_member_lookup(mp_obj_t self, const mp_obj_type_t *type, mp_obj_t member, mp_obj_t *dest) {
+ if (MP_OBJ_IS_TYPE(member, &mp_type_staticmethod)) {
+ // return just the function
+ dest[0] = ((mp_obj_static_class_method_t*)member)->fun;
+ } else if (MP_OBJ_IS_TYPE(member, &mp_type_classmethod)) {
+ // return a bound method, with self being the type of this object
+ dest[0] = ((mp_obj_static_class_method_t*)member)->fun;
+ dest[1] = (mp_obj_t)type;
+ } else if (MP_OBJ_IS_TYPE(member, &mp_type_type)) {
+ // Don't try to bind types (even though they're callable)
+ dest[0] = member;
+ } else if (mp_obj_is_callable(member)) {
+ // return a bound method, with self being this object
+ dest[0] = member;
+ dest[1] = self;
+ } else {
+ // class member is a value, so just return that value
+ dest[0] = member;
+ }
+}
+
// no attribute found, returns: dest[0] == MP_OBJ_NULL, dest[1] == MP_OBJ_NULL
// normal attribute found, returns: dest[0] == <attribute>, dest[1] == MP_OBJ_NULL
// method attribute found, returns: dest[0] == <method>, dest[1] == <self>
